WebMay 23, 2016 · Drop down the control box in the ceiling of the refrigerator to access the thermistor. Examine the thermistor's wire harness for damage or loose connections. If the wiring harness looks okay, let’s check the resistance of the thermistor using a multimeter. Remove the thermistor and put the meter leads on the two white wires. WebDirty Condenser Coils. One of the most common causes of fridge temperature fluctuations is dirty condenser coils. These coils are located on the back or bottom of the fridge and can become clogged with dust, dirt, and pet hair over time. When the condenser coils are dirty, they can’t release heat effectively, causing the fridge to work harder ...
